Xiaomi Mi 2 Band = R200 (Import from Gearbest) so really cheap.

As for reason: Tells time without removing phone from pocket, vibrate when I get call/SMS/Whatsapp. I work in a factory env where I don't always hear the phone and sometime leave my phone on desk in office, so Bluetooth range helps with that. Does heart rate monitor for points.

Best is I don't need to remove it for shower and only charge it once a month.
